Sixty-four million dollars has been set as the target for a 72-hour fundraising campaign to help Syrian refugees.

On Monday, the UN World Food Programme (WFP) announced that it was suspending the provision of food vouchers to nearly 1.7 million Syrian refugees due to a lack of funding.

Those people fled Syria over the past three years as a result of the ongoing conflict in the country.

Now people around the world are being asked to contribute one US dollar in order to pay for the reinstatement of the vouchers.

Reem Abaza asked Laure Chadraoui who is a WFP Spokesperson based in Dubai about the campaign.
